About
Exer Urgent Care operates a walk-in medical facility in North Hollywood offering immediate care for non-emergency health concerns. Open seven days a week from 8 AM to 8 PM, the clinic provides accessible healthcare without requiring an appointment for acute illnesses, injuries, and minor procedures.
